Electricity units syllabus

Questions on electricity units can test recall, calculations, explanations, diagrams, data handling and practical skills. You should be able to:

  • 2.1 use the following units: ampere (A), coulomb (C), joule (J), ohm (Ω), second (s), volt (V) and watt (W)

How to answer electricity units questions

  1. Write the unit symbol exactly and distinguish quantities that use similar-looking units.
  2. Convert prefixes and compound units before substituting values into an equation.
  3. Check that the unit of the final answer matches the quantity asked for.
  4. Use the context of a diagram or calculation to reject units with the wrong dimensions.

Example 1: Using a Diagram

Question 1

This question is about electrostatics. A student uses a plastic rod to investigate electrostatics. Photograph of a hand holding a plastic rod used for an electrostatics investigation. The student uses a meter to measure the amount of charge on the rod.
The meter displays a reading of –5.2mC.
Which of these is the same as –5.2mC?
A –0.52C
B –0.052C
C –0.0052C
D –0.00052C

Final answer

C –0.0052 C

Mark scheme points

  1. M1 Selects C, –0.0052 C.

Explanation

The prefix milli means \(10^{-3}\), so convert millicoulombs to coulombs by multiplying by \(0.001\).

–5.2 mC = –5.2 × 10⁻³ C
        = –0.0052 C

The negative sign is unchanged.

Common mistakes

  • Using \(10^{-2}\) instead of \(10^{-3}\) for the prefix milli.
  • Moving the decimal point the wrong number of places.
  • Dropping or changing the negative sign during the conversion.
